Why this album works

'Fresh Aire Interludes' is significant for its role in popularizing new-age music, reaching notable positions on the Billboard charts. The album contributed to Mannheim Steamroller's reputation as pioneers in blending classical and modern electronic elements, influencing many artists within the genre and beyond.

Context
Released in 1981, 'Fresh Aire Interludes' marks Mannheim Steamroller's third album, following their breakthrough with 'Fresh Aire I'. At this point in their career, the group had already begun to carve a niche within the emerging new-age genre, utilizing innovative instrumentation and production techniques that would define their sound.
